Features
| Voltage regulation accuracy ±0,25% |
| THD-tolerant design offers reliable operation with nonlinear loads |
| True RMS three-phase generator voltage sensing/regulation |

| Auto tuning feature |
| Soft start and voltage buildup control |
| Integrated droop and cross current compensation |
| Diodes failure detection |
| Remote setpoint control input accepts analog voltage or current control signal |
| Real-time metering |

| Eight programmable contact-sensing inputs |
| Three contact outputs |
| Flexible communication: Serial communication through USB port and Ethernet communication |
| Data logging and sequence of events |
| USB powered for programming via BESTCOMSPlus software |
